Distance and estimated driving time

Driving from Hattiesburg to Slidell covers approximately 82 miles via I-59 S. The trip is estimated to take around 1 hour and 15 minutes, making it a relatively short and convenient journey. Travelers can expect smooth navigation along the interstate, with potential scenic views along the route. Planning ahead for any traffic delays can ensure a timely arrival at your destination.

Vehicle maintenance advice for long-distance driving

When preparing for a long-distance road trip from Hattiesburg to Slidell, proper vehicle maintenance is essential to ensure safety and minimize breakdowns. Before departure, check your tire pressure, tread wear, and ensure your spare tire is in good condition. Additionally, inspect fluid levels including engine oil, coolant, brake fluid, and windshield washer fluid, topping them off as needed. Finally, verify that your brakes, lights, and battery are functioning correctly to prevent any unexpected issues along the route.
